Goethe Medal Awarded to Li Yuan, Van Reybrouck, and Kavala

The Goethe Medal, a prestigious German award, was given to Chinese linguist Li Yuan, Belgian historian David Van Reybrouck, and Turkish activist Osman Kavala for their contributions to cultural understanding and democracy; the ceremony will be on August 28th in Weimar.

Assault on CHP Leader: Suspect Claims Unplanned Attack

Selçuk Tengioğlu, who assaulted CHP leader Özgür Özel at the Atatürk Cultural Center, claimed the attack was unplanned, citing Özel's past remarks and his own emotional state as motivation. Tengioğlu, who was apprehended by authorities, stated that no one instructed or paid him.

Turkey's Major Military Exercises in May

Turkey's armed forces are planning two major military exercises in May, "Denizkurdu II 2025" and "Phoenix of Anatolia 2025," involving over 20,000 troops across various locations and prompting a response from Greece with its own "Storm" exercise.

Istanbul Femicide: Ex-Husband Kills Woman in Street

In Istanbul's Şişli district, Bahar Aksu was shot and killed by her ex-husband, Rüstem Elibol, on the morning of [Date not specified]. Elibol and three accomplices were later arrested in Silivri. Aksu had previously filed police reports against Elibol.

Trump and Erdogan Discuss Ukraine War Resolution

Former U.S. President Donald Trump spoke with Turkish President Erdogan on Monday, expressing his desire to collaborate on ending the Russo-Ukrainian War; Erdogan invited Trump to Turkey and Washington; they also discussed Syria, Gaza, and Iran.
